Is Fairhope or Mobile Safer?
According to crimebycity.com's analysis of 2024 FBI data, Fairhope is safer than Mobile (Safety Score 64/100 vs 30/100), with a total crime rate of 1,261 per 100,000 versus 2,426 for Mobile — 48% lower. Fairhope has lower rates in 7 of 7 crime categories.
The biggest difference is in murder, where Fairhope has a 100% lower rate.
Note: Mobile is 9.2x larger by coverage, which can affect crime rate comparisons. Larger cities tend to report higher rates due to density and more comprehensive reporting.

Detailed Crime Rate Comparison
| Crime Type | Fairhope | Mobile |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total Crime Rate | 1,260.6 | 2,426.5 | -1,165.9 |
| Violent Crime Rate | 108.6 | 752.0 | -643.4 |
| Murder Rate | 0.0 | 16.5 | -16.5 |
| Rape Rate | 23.3 | 26.2 | -2.9 |
| Robbery Rate | 15.5 | 52.7 | -37.2 |
| Aggravated Assault Rate | 69.8 | 656.7 | -586.9 |
| Property Crime Rate | 1,152.0 | 1,674.5 | -522.5 |
| Burglary Rate | 81.5 | 313.4 | -231.9 |
| Larceny-Theft Rate | 1,035.6 | 1,188.6 | -153.0 |
| Motor Vehicle Theft Rate | 34.9 | 172.5 | -137.6 |
All rates per 100,000 residents. Source: FBI UCR 2024.

About Fairhope, AL
Fairhope, Alabama, a town on Mobile Bay, was founded in 1894 as a "single tax" colony. This coastal community, known for its scenic bluff, has a population of over 23,000. With a safety score of 64/100 and a population coverage of 25,782, Fairhope has a total crime rate of 1,260.6 per 100,000 residents.
